About Us

The Agency for Clinical Innovation (ACI) leads innovation in clinical care across NSW. We do this by bringing clinicians, patients and healthcare managers together to design and implement new ways to deliver healthcare.

For more information go to

What You Will Be Doing

The Intensive and Urgent Care Data Manager will undertake advanced statistical and data analyses of intensive care information that will lead to strategic improvements in the quality of Intensive Care Services across NSW. The Intensive Urgent Care Data Manager will work collaboratively with the ICNSW Director, ICNSW Network Manager, ICNSW staff to provide comprehensive data analysis services to support the work plans and research projects for ICNSW.

COVID-19 Vaccination Compliancy

All NSW Health workers are required to have completed a primary course of a COVID-19 vaccine which has been approved or recognised by the Therapeutics Goods Administration (TGA). Additionally, Category A workers are required to receive a booster dose three months after completing the primary course of COVID-19 vaccinations. New applicants must have completed the vaccination course prior to commencement with NSW Health, or provide an approved medical contraindication certificate (IM011 immunisation medical exemption form) certifying the worker cannot have any approved COVID-19 vaccines available in NSW.

Acceptable proof of vaccination is the Australian Immunisation Register (AIR) Immunisation History Statement or AIR COVID-19 Digital Certificate. Booster doses are highly recommended for all health care workers who have completed the primary course of COVID-19 vaccinations.
